Description

Portrait of Thomas Pleasants (1728-1818), Irish landowner and philanthropist. The subject depicted full length, seated, in three-quarter left profile and gazing front; in an open-arm, red-upholstered fauteuil-style armchair, against the rear left support of which rests a leather-bound volume, the spine inscribed in gold lettering VISITORS OBSERVATIONS STOVE TENTER HOUSE; his left arm on the armrest, his right arm on a red cloth-covered table upon which are a silver tray with a pen and inkwell, a pocket-watch, two small, thin books and a plan of the front elevation of the Gate House, Botanic Garden[s], Glasnevin (for the construction of which, Pleasants donated £700 to the [Royal] Dublin Society in 1815); wearing dark-coloured frock coat, waistcoat and breeches, white stock, jabot and ruffled cuffs and black, knee high boots; set against a background with a window, draped with a red-and-gold damask curtain, through which the façade of the Stove Tenter House, Dublin (for the construction of which, Pleasants donated £13,000 in 1814) can be seen. Signed with monogram and dated lower right, SW 1820. Provenance: The Pleasants Bequest, 1818.
